Billing
Dados da Cobrança
type Billing {
externalToken: String
nn: String
description: String
value: Decimal!
originalValue: Decimal!
dueDate: DateTime!
competenceDate: DateTime
interestValue: Decimal
interestPercentage: Decimal
fineValue: Decimal
amountPaid: Decimal
refundValue: Decimal
paymentDate: DateTime
refundDate: DateTime
billingStatus: BillingStatus
discount: Decimal
barcode: String
barcodeUrl: String
digitableLine: String
pixCode: String
paymentType: PaymentType
documentCode: String
financialOwnerId: Int!
financialOwner: FinancialOwner!
paymentPlanId: Int!
paymentPlan: PaymentPlan!
firstBillingId: Int
firstBilling: Billing
parentBillingId: Int
parentBilling: Billing
financialIntegrationId: Int
financialIntegration: FinancialIntegration
atmPaymentId: Int
atmPayment: AtmPayment
cancellationReason: CancellationReason
cancellationDescription: String
refundReason: RefundReason
refundDescription: String
reissueReason: ReissueReason
reissueDescription: String
cancelAfterRegister: Boolean
hasRefund: Boolean
isManualPayment: Boolean!
reasonForManualPaymentId: Int
reasonForManualPayment: ReasonForManualPayment
billingUpdates: [BillingUpdate!]!
punctualDiscounts: [PunctualDiscount!]
apiRequestLogs: [ApiRequestLog!]
graphQLRequestLogs: [GraphQLRequestLog!]
isFromAgreement: Boolean
billingAgreements: [BillingAgreement!]!
paymentLinks(
where: PaymentLinkFilterInput
order: [PaymentLinkSortInput!]
): [PaymentLink!]!
duplicate: Boolean
duplicationReason: String
ownershipExchangeId: Int
ownershipExchange: OwnershipExchange
id: Int!
refId: UUID!
externalId: Int
creationDate: DateTime!
active: Boolean!
deleted: Boolean!
changes: [LogHistory!]!
lastUpdateDate: DateTime
hasAnyManualPayment: Boolean! @deprecated
itIsPayable: Boolean!
itIsReissuable: Boolean!
itIsPrintable: Boolean!
barcodeBase64: String!
calculatedIncreaseValue: Decimal!
calculatedFineValue: Decimal!
updatedValue: Decimal!
updatedComptenceDate: DateTime!
pendingUpdates: [BillingUpdate!]!
}
Fields
Billing.externalToken ● String scalar
Token externo
Billing.nn ● String scalar
Nosso número
Billing.description ● String scalar
Descrição
Billing.value ● Decimal! non-null scalar
Valor
Billing.originalValue ● Decimal! non-null scalar
Valor original
Billing.dueDate ● DateTime! non-null scalar
Data de vencimento
Billing.competenceDate ● DateTime scalar
Data de competência
Billing.interestValue ● Decimal scalar
Juros
Billing.interestPercentage ● Decimal scalar
Porcentagem de Juros
Billing.fineValue ● Decimal scalar
Multa
Billing.amountPaid ● Decimal scalar
Valor pago
Billing.refundValue ● Decimal scalar
Valor estornado
Billing.paymentDate ● DateTime scalar
Data do pagamento
Billing.refundDate ● DateTime scalar
Data do estorno
Billing.billingStatus ● BillingStatus enum
Status da cobrança
Billing.discount ● Decimal scalar
Desconto
Billing.barcode ● String scalar
Código de barras
Billing.barcodeUrl ● String scalar
Url do código de barras
Billing.digitableLine ● String scalar
Linha digitável
Billing.pixCode ● String scalar
Código do Pix
Billing.paymentType ● PaymentType enum
Tipo de pagamento
Billing.documentCode ● String scalar
Código do documento
Billing.financialOwnerId ● Int! non-null scalar
Id do responsável financeiro
Billing.financialOwner ● FinancialOwner! non-null object
Dados do responsável financeiro
Billing.paymentPlanId ● Int! non-null scalar
Id do plano de pagamento
Billing.paymentPlan ● PaymentPlan! non-null object
Dados do plano de pagamento
Billing.firstBillingId ● Int scalar
Id da primeira cobrança
Billing.firstBilling ● Billing object
Primeira cobrança
Billing.parentBillingId ● Int scalar
Id da cobrança pai
Billing.parentBilling ● Billing object
Cobrança pai
Billing.financialIntegrationId ● Int scalar
Id da integração financeira
Billing.financialIntegration ● FinancialIntegration object
Dados da integração financeira
Billing.atmPaymentId ● Int scalar
Id do pagamento em ATM
Billing.atmPayment ● AtmPayment object
Dados do pagamento em ATM
Billing.cancellationReason ● CancellationReason enum
Motivo de cancelamento
Billing.cancellationDescription ● String scalar
Descrição do motivo de cancelamento
Billing.refundReason ● RefundReason enum
Motivo do estorno
Billing.refundDescription ● String scalar
Descrição do motivo de estorno
Billing.reissueReason ● ReissueReason enum
Motivo da 2ª via
Billing.reissueDescription ● String scalar
Descrição do motivo da 2ª via
Billing.cancelAfterRegister ● Boolean scalar
Marca a cobrança para ser cancelada após o registro
Billing.hasRefund ● Boolean scalar
Marca se a cobrança foi estornada
Billing.isManualPayment ● Boolean! non-null scalar
Indicador de pagamento manual
Billing.reasonForManualPaymentId ● Int scalar
Id do Motivo da baixa manual
Billing.reasonForManualPayment ● ReasonForManualPayment object
Motivo da baixa manual
Billing.billingUpdates ● [BillingUpdate!]! non-null object
Atualizações
Billing.punctualDiscounts ● [PunctualDiscount!] list object
Descontos pontualidade
Billing.apiRequestLogs ● [ApiRequestLog!] list object
Billing.graphQLRequestLogs ● [GraphQLRequestLog!] list object
Billing.isFromAgreement ● Boolean scalar
Indica se o boleto foi gerado por um acordo
Billing.billingAgreements ● [BillingAgreement!]! non-null object
Acordos associados à cobrança
Billing.paymentLinks ● [PaymentLink!]! non-null object
Links de pagamento
Billing.paymentLinks.where●PaymentLinkFilterInputinput
Billing.paymentLinks.order ● [PaymentLinkSortInput!] list input
Billing.duplicate ● Boolean scalar
Cobrança duplicada?
Billing.duplicationReason ● String scalar
Motivo da duplicação
Billing.ownershipExchangeId ● Int scalar
Id do lote de tombamento
Billing.ownershipExchange ● OwnershipExchange object
Lote de tombamento
Billing.id ● Int! non-null scalar
Id do objeto da Requisição
Billing.refId ● UUID! non-null scalar
Id da Referência
Billing.externalId ● Int scalar
Id Externo
Billing.creationDate ● DateTime! non-null scalar
Data de Criação
Billing.active ● Boolean! non-null scalar
Status de Ativação
Billing.deleted ● Boolean! non-null scalar
Status de Deleção
Billing.changes ● [LogHistory!]! non-null object
Histórico de alterações
Billing.lastUpdateDate ● DateTime scalar
Data da ultima atualização
Billing.hasAnyManualPayment ● Boolean! deprecated non-null scalar
DEPRECATEDUsar a propriedade 'isManualPayment'
Billing.itIsPayable ● Boolean! non-null scalar
Billing.itIsReissuable ● Boolean! non-null scalar
Billing.itIsPrintable ● Boolean! non-null scalar
Billing.barcodeBase64 ● String! non-null scalar
Billing.calculatedIncreaseValue ● Decimal! non-null scalar
Billing.calculatedFineValue ● Decimal! non-null scalar
Billing.updatedValue ● Decimal! non-null scalar
Billing.updatedComptenceDate ● DateTime! non-null scalar
Billing.pendingUpdates ● [BillingUpdate!]! non-null object
Returned By
amountPaid query ● billing query ● printBilling query
Member Of
ApiRequestLog object ● AtmPayment object ● Billing object ● BillingAgreement object ● BillingsCollectionSegment object ● BillingUpdate object ● FinancialOwner object ● GraphQLRequestLog object ● OwnershipExchange object ● PaginatedResultOfBilling object ● PaymentLink object ● PaymentPlan object ● PunctualDiscount object